The most fun car I've ever broken
My 2007 Cobalt SS was the best car I've ever broken. I bought it in march of 2016, as my first manual transmission car. It was about 200 miles from my house and taking it home was an adventure all on its own. The next day was the real trip though. Taking it down to San Antonio, Texas from Kansas, then down to South Padre for Spring Break. This car was the best way to learn a 5 speed gearbox. Burning out the clutch was my fault though. (taking a new to me car on a 1000 mile trip wasn't smart.) The repair on it was around $1200 parts and labor. So not terrible for a supercharged car clutch replacement. The end of 2016 is where I really had my sad times though. Blowing the head gasket on one of these cars is not a common thing to run into, so don't let me scare you. But it was all my fault anyways! This car is something I had dreamt of as a high school kid, wanting some exciting car to impress chicks. So I would recommend buying one of these cars if you ever get the chance, just don't do what I did, pushing it 110% 120% of the time you drive it.

Total throw away car!
Great if bought new or low mileage used without problems. I bought it with 143k miles, $700 total. Average in look, so simple and plain interior, problem after problem. These cars are not made to last a long time, even if you take care of it like the manual suggests, they are made cheap, sold cheap, and meant to be a temporary vehicle until you can upgrade hopefully before everything starts messing up.
